Can the training provider choose dates for EPA?

L
Written by Lucy Kelford

Training providers can share preferred dates for End-Point Assessment (EPA), but final scheduling is subject to availability and cannot be guaranteed.

Providing Preferred Dates

When submitting a learner to gateway in ACE360, providers have the opportunity to:

  • Indicate preferred EPA dates

  • Highlight any scheduling preferences that align with employer or learner availability

These preferences will be taken into consideration during the booking process.

Availability and Scheduling

  • An EPA Coordinator will review all preferred dates provided

  • While EAL will make every effort to accommodate these preferences, this is not guaranteed, as scheduling depends on factors such as:

    • Assessor availability

    • The specific standard and pathway

    • Location and logistics

Providing Unavailable Dates

Providers can also support effective scheduling by:

  • Supplying dates when the learner is unavailable (e.g. annual leave, work commitments)

During the booking process:

  • These dates will be avoided wherever possible, helping to reduce the need for rescheduling

Best Practice

To improve the likelihood of securing suitable dates, providers should:

  • Provide clear and realistic preferred dates at the point of gateway submission

  • Include any known constraints or blackout periods

  • Ensure information is accurate and up to date
